In physics, the algebraic sum refers to the total sum of a set of quantities, including their sign. The sign indicates the direction or orientation of the quantity in question.
For example, if you consider the displacement of an object, it can be positive if the object moves in one direction and negative if it moves in the opposite direction. The algebraic sum of the displacements of the object will take into account both the magnitude and the direction of the displacement.
Similarly, if you consider the forces acting on an object, some forces can act in the same direction, while others act in opposite directions. The algebraic sum of all the forces acting on the object will give you the net force acting on the object, taking into account both the magnitude and the direction of each force.
In summary, the algebraic sum in physics involves adding up a set of quantities, taking into account their sign or direction, to determine the total or net effect of those quantities.
